Usage Warnings
Outdoor Furniture Sets
Safety warnings and precautions
Main risks
- Tipping or instability due to uneven surfaces, incorrect assembly, or overloading.
- Collapse due to loose fixings, damaged joints, or worn parts.
- Finger entrapment in hinges, folding mechanisms, or when stacking chairs.
- Cuts or splinters from damaged edges, and breakage of table tops, especially glass, due to impact or thermal shock.
- Burns from metal or glass surfaces that can heat up in the sun.
- Slips and falls on wet floors or on surfaces with sand/dust.
- Toppling or lightweight items being blown away by gusts of wind, especially parasols.
- Fire or burns from proximity to barbecues, heaters, or other sources of heat and open flames.
- Mould, corrosion, or material weakening due to prolonged exposure to moisture and sunlight.
- Injuries when lifting or moving bulky or heavy items.
Safe use
- Assemble according to the product instructions and check that all fixings are properly tightened before use.
- Place the set on a firm, level surface, leaving safe clearance around it.
- Check stability before sitting or applying weight; avoid rocking or making sudden movements.
- Respect the maximum load and the intended use of each piece; do not stand or sit on the table or on armrests.
- For folding or extendable items, keep hands away from hinges and ensure the locks are engaged before use.
- With glass table tops, avoid knocks and impacts and do not place very hot or very cold objects directly; use coasters or trivets.
- On windy days, close and remove parasols and secure lightweight items.
- Keep the furniture away from barbecues, fireplaces, and heating appliances.
- If the floor or furniture is wet, dry them before use to reduce the risk of slipping.
- To move items, lift without dragging; use gloves and assistance from another person if necessary.
- During assembly, keep screws and small parts out of the reach of children and pets.
Storage and maintenance
- Periodically check screws, joints, and stability; retighten and replace worn or damaged parts.
- Clean with water and pH-neutral soap or products appropriate for the material; avoid abrasives and high-pressure jets at close range.
- Dry thoroughly after cleaning or rain to minimise rust, mould, or swelling.
- Protect with breathable covers when not in use and, if possible, store under cover during periods of bad weather.
- Store cushions and textiles in a dry, ventilated place; air them regularly to prevent unpleasant odours and mould.
- Inspect glass table tops regularly; if they show impacts, chips, or instability, stop using them until they are replaced.
- In coastal areas, rinse with fresh water periodically to reduce the effect of salt spray.
- Fit protectors to the legs to avoid direct contact with standing water and to protect the floor.
- Check parasol bases and anchors frequently and replace them if they are cracked or unstable.
- Avoid continuous exposure to intense sun when not in use to reduce discolouration and excessive heating.
Usage restrictions
- Do not use as a ladder, platform, workbench, or exercise equipment.
- Do not hang from or swing on chairs, backrests, or table edges; do not sit on the table.
- Do not exceed the stated load capacity for seats, tables, and auxiliary shelves.
- Do not use parasols open in strong winds or leave them open unattended.
- Do not bring open flames, embers, or heating appliances close to cushions, textiles, or wooden parts.
- Do not use on very soft or uneven surfaces that compromise stability.
- Do not drag heavy furniture; it can damage the product and cause injury.
- During severe frosts, avoid moving fragile items or operating folding mechanisms.
- Children should use the furniture under supervision and must not climb or play in gaps or on structural parts.
- During assembly or when there are loose parts, keep them out of the reach of children and pets.
